Why Choose MS in Biomedical Science & Engineering at Hanyang University, South Korea

Choosing an MS in Biomedical Science & Engineering at Hanyang University, South Korea, offers a unique blend of cutting-edge research and practical experience. The program provides access to state-of-the-art laboratories, interdisciplinary courses, and collaborations with leading hospitals and biotech companies. Students gain expertise in biomaterials, medical imaging, and tissue engineering while engaging in innovative projects that address real-world healthcare challenges. Hanyang’s strong industry connections enhance internship and career opportunities, while its vibrant campus culture and international student support create a dynamic learning environment. Pursuing this degree equips graduates with advanced skills and global perspectives, preparing them for impactful careers in biomedical research and healthcare technology.


MS in Biomedical Science & Engineering at Hanyang University, South Korea, Program Details
 

Category

Details

Program Name

MS in Biomedical Science & Engineering

Degree Awarded

Master of Science (MS)

Course Duration

2 years (full-time)

Language of Instruction

English/Korean (depends on course selection)

Yearly Tuition Fees

Approx. 5,000 – 6,000 USD

Total Tuition Fees

Approx. 10,000 – 12,000 USD

Total Program Cost

Approx. 12,000 – 15,000 USD (including living expenses)

Eligibility

Bachelor’s degree in Biomedical Science, Biotechnology, Life Sciences, or related fields; GPA ≥ 3.0/4.0

Admission Requirements

Academic transcripts, statement of purpose, recommendation letters, English proficiency (TOEFL/IELTS), interview (if required)

Application Intake

Fall Semester: September; Spring Semester: March

Scholarship

University scholarships, Korean Government Scholarship Program (KGSP), Research/Teaching Assistantships

Career Prospects

Biomedical researcher, clinical engineer, biotech analyst, medical device developer, PhD opportunities

Curriculum Structure

Core courses (Biomedical Engineering Principles, Biomaterials, Medical Imaging), Electives (Tissue Engineering, Bioinformatics), Research Thesis/Project, Seminars & Workshops
